ChromeGuard designs and manufactures protection solutions for mining and civil equipment. We work directly with customers to reduce risk and improve productivity in demanding operating environments, and we are growing our product range and global customer base.
We are looking for a hands-on mechanical designer who can combine strong CAD capability with confident customer communication. You will join our Sales team, own qualified technical opportunities from discovery through prototype fitment and field validation, then complete a clear handover to Product Development for final engineering and release.
The role
Reporting to the Sales Manager, you will be the technical link between customers, BDMs, distributors and the teams that turn an idea into a physical product. You will investigate the need, create and present concepts, coordinate prototypes and stay involved through fitment and validation. Working closely with Product Development, drafting, workshop and production, you will then hand over a complete package for final verification, production drawings, BOMs, controlled documentation and formal release.
What you will be doing
- Own qualified opportunities and the Sales Engineering workflow from intake through validation, handover or closure, including clear priorities, actions and status updates.
- Lead discovery with customers, BDMs and distributors; obtain and interpret the machine details, measurements, photographs, constraints, timing and required outcome, including from remote international stakeholders.
- Create sketches, 3D CAD models, layouts and prototype-level drawings that consider fit, movement, clearances, installation, durability, fabrication and assembly.
- Develop and present practical concepts and technical proposals, clearly explaining the perks, assumptions, limitations, information gaps and next steps.
- Coordinate approved prototype manufacture, fitment and trials; attend or oversee site assessments, installations and field validations, then drive agreed iterations through to validation or closure.
- Complete a structured post-validation handover covering the customer need, validated design intent, CAD and prototype drawings, fitment outcomes, acceptance criteria, risks and unresolved items.
- Remain the Sales and customer liaison after handover, providing clarification, protecting the agreed scope and keeping stakeholders informed.
- Turn field learning into product improvements, technical advice, while maintaining accurate opportunity records.
What we are looking for
- Experience in industrial product development, mechanical design, technical sales support or a related practical role.
- Strong 3D CAD capability, preferably in SolidWorks, including concept models, layouts and drawings suitable for prototype manufacture.
- Practical mechanical design judgement across fit, movement, clearances, installation, durability, fabrication and assembly.
- A clear, confident communication style and the ability to ask precise questions,
present concepts and translate customer needs into defined technical requirements.
- Strong problem-solving, organisation and follow-through across several opportunities, stakeholders and site actions.
- A hands-on approach and willingness to visit sites, investigate issues and follow a product through to a validated outcome.
- A current driver's licence.
Experience with mining or heavy equipment, fabrication, workshop or manufacturing environments, field installations, product trials or technical documentation would be highly regarded.
